Visual Basic for Applications Functions

Microsoft® SQL Server™ OLAP Services supports many functions in the Microsoft Visual Basic® for Applications Expression Services library. This library is included with OLAP Services and automatically registered. Functions not supported in this release are marked by an asterisk in the table below.

Abs *Add *AppActivate *Array
Asc AscB AscW Atn
*Beep *Calendar *CallByName CBool
CByte CCur CDate CDbl
*CDec *ChDir *ChDrive *Choose
Chr *ChrB ChrW CInt
*Clear CLng *Command Cos
*Count *CreateObject CSng CStr
CurDir CVar CVDate *CVErr
Date DateAdd DateDiff DatePart
DateSerial DateValue Day DDB
*DeleteSetting *Description *Dir *DoEvents
Environ *EOF *Err *Error
Exp *FileAttr *FileCopy FileDateTime
FileLen *Filter Fix Format
*FormatCurrency *FormatDateTime *FormatNumber *FormatPercent
*FreeFile FV *GetAllSettings *GetAttr
*GetObject *GetSetting *HelpContext *HelpFile
Hex Hour IIf *IMEStatus
*Input *InputB *InputBox InStr
InStrB *InStrRev Int IPmt
*IRR *IsArray IsDate *IsEmpty
IsError *IsMissing IsNull IsNumeric
*IsObject *Item *Join *Kill
*LastDllError LCase Left LeftB
Len LenB *Loc *LOF
Log LTrim Mid MidB
Minute *MIRR *MkDir Month
*MonthName *MsgBox Now NPer
*NPV *Number Oct *Partition
Pmt PPmt PV QBColor
*Raise *Randomize Rate *Remove
*Replace *Reset RGB Right
RightB *RmDir Rnd Round
RTrim *SaveSetting Second *Seek
*SendKeys *SetAttr Sgn Shell
Sin SLN *Source Space
*Split Sqr Str StrComp
String *StrReverse *Switch SYD
Tan Time Timer TimeSerial
TimeValue Trim TypeName UCase
Val *VarType Weekday *WeekdayName
*Width Year    

(c) 1988-1998 Microsoft Corporation. All Rights Reserved.